Media timeline processing infrastructure

A basic structure and timeline technology, applied in the media field, can solve problems such as inefficient use of computer hardware and software resources

Inactive Publication Date: 2009-08-05
MICROSOFT CORP
View PDF0 Cites 6 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

This can lead to inefficient use of computer hardware and software resources

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Media timeline processing infrastructure
  • Media timeline processing infrastructure
  • Media timeline processing infrastructure

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0023] Overview

[0024] A media timeline processing infrastructure is described. The media timeline provides the user with a media-defined presentation based on the media, such as existing media (e.g., stored media such as videos, songs, documents, etc.) and / or "real-time" output from media sources such as streaming audio and / or video Technology. The Media Timeline can be used to express groupings and / or combinations of media and provide compositional metadata used by the Media Timeline processing infrastructure that executes (e.g., renders) the media referenced by the Media Timeline to provide the final presented.

[0025] Different multimedia applications may have different media timeline object models for handling media collections. For example, a media player can use playlists to play media in order. On the other hand, an editing application can edit a presentation of the media using a media timeline configured as a storyboard. Another application can use an event-ba...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A media timeline processing infrastructure is described. In an implementation, one or more computer readable media include computer executable instructs that, when executed, provide an infrastructure having an application programming interface that is configured to accept a plurality of segments from an application for sequential rendering. Each of the segments reference at least one media item for rendering by the infrastructure and each segment is taken from a media timeline by an application.

Description

technical field [0001] The present invention relates generally to media, and more particularly to a media timeline processing infrastructure. Background technique [0002] Users of computers, such as desktop PCs, set-top boxes, personal digital assistants (PDAs), etc., have access to an ever-increasing amount of media from an ever-increasing variety of sources. For example, a user may interact with a desktop PC executing multiple applications to provide media for output such as home videos, songs, slide presentations, and the like. Users can also utilize the set-top box to receive traditional television programming that is broadcast to the set-top box via the broadcast network. Additionally, the set-top box can be configured as a personal video recorder (PVR), whereby a user can store broadcast content in memory on the set-top box for later playback. In addition, a user can interact with a wireless phone that executes a number of applications that allow the user to read an...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G11B27/00H04N21/845
CPCH04N21/8456G11B27/322G11B27/034G06Q50/10
Inventor A·V·格里格罗维奇S·U·拉赫曼S·B·穆罕默德G·T·顿巴
Owner MICROSOFT C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products